1What are the most common types of restoration emergencies for homes in Mineral, IL, and when are they most likely to occur?

In Mineral, the most frequent emergencies are water damage from burst pipes or appliance failures and storm damage from high winds and hail. These are particularly prevalent during our harsh Illinois winters due to freezing and thawing cycles, and during the spring and summer thunderstorm season. Proactive maintenance of roofing and plumbing before these seasons is highly recommended.

2How do I choose a reliable restoration company in the Mineral/Bureau County area?

Always verify that the company is licensed and insured to operate in Illinois. Look for local companies with 24/7 emergency response, as they understand our specific weather challenges and can arrive quickly. Check for certifications from the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C) and read reviews from other local homeowners to gauge reliability and quality of work.

4Does homeowner's insurance in Illinois typically cover restoration services like water or fire damage?

Most standard Illinois homeowner's insurance policies do cover sudden and accidental events, like a pipe bursting or a lightning-caused fire. However, they often exclude damage from lack of maintenance (e.g., long-term seepage) or flooding, which requires separate flood insurance. It's crucial to contact your insurer immediately after a disaster and work with a restoration company experienced in navigating Illinois insurance claims.

5After a fire, what are the specific steps a restoration company will take for my home in Mineral?

The process includes securing the property (board-up/tarping), a thorough assessment of soot and structural damage, water removal from firefighting efforts, specialized cleaning of contents and surfaces, odor removal, and finally, reconstruction. Given Mineral's older housing stock, a quality local contractor will pay special attention to historic materials and ensure repairs meet current Illinois building codes while preserving the home's character.
